Overview
- Netflix released all eight episodes worldwide on November 13, enabling full-season binge viewing.
- The limited series follows grieving author Aggie Wiggs as she fixates on neighbor Nile Jarvis, a wealthy heir long suspected in his first wife’s disappearance.
- The creative team is led by creator Gabe Rotter and showrunner Howard Gordon with episodes directed by Antonio Campos.
- Executive producers include Jodie Foster and Conan O’Brien, and the ensemble features Brittany Snow, Natalie Morales, Jonathan Banks and David Lyons.
- Critics broadly praise Danes and Rhys’s performances and atmosphere, note parallels to true‑crime stories such as The Jinx, and differ on pacing and the finale.
